Prepare to lead in an increasingly complex world

While data and technology are transforming the way we do business, human relationships remain at the core of success. Organizations need impactful leaders who can foster a healthy culture and develop effective workforce management strategies. 

Our Leading People & Organizations concentration will prepare you to lead and manage in ways that empower employees and achieve organizational goals. Through coursework in building and leading teams, negotiating, forming inclusive organizations, and more, you'll develop strong communication and leadership skills, as well as the cultural agility to operate globally. With a focus on the digital future of business, you'll also gain a deeper understanding of how emerging technologies like AI and robotics impact the workforce—preparing you to create and nurture effective teams now and in the future.
